What You'll Do
As a Technical Project Manager / Scrum Master, you'll lead Agile ceremonies, ensuring alignment across business and technical stakeholders.
You'll serve as the central point of coordination, driving clarity on requirements, risks, dependencies, and delivery timelines.
Facilitate sprint planning, daily standups, retrospectives, and backlog refinement sessions.
Translate business objectives into structured user stories, acceptance criteria, and delivery milestones.
Track project progress, surfacing blockers early and ensuring accountability across teams.
Build and maintain detailed project documentation, including technical workflows, integration points, and success metrics.
Act as a liaison between product owners, engineers, QA, and leadership to ensure priorities are aligned and transparent.
Support continuous improvement by implementing Agile best practices and coaching team members on process adoption.
Deliver structured status updates and reporting to stakeholders, highlighting risks, dependencies, and mitigation strategies.
